Updated config in app module, fixed typo

This commit is contained in:
daniel oeh 2014-10-19 19:21:51 +02:00
parent eff021c149
commit 2cd504b9d0
9 changed files with 62 additions and 28 deletions

View File

@ -2,31 +2,31 @@
host = https://www.transifex.com
[antennapod.english]
source_file = res/values/strings.xml
source_file = core/src/main/res/values/strings.xml
source_lang = en
trans.az = res/values-az/strings.xml
trans.ca = res/values-ca/strings.xml
trans.cs_CZ = res/values-cs-rCZ/strings.xml
trans.da = res/values-da/strings.xml
trans.de = res/values-de/strings.xml
trans.es = res/values-es/strings.xml
trans.es_ES = res/values-es-rES/strings.xml
trans.fr = res/values-fr/strings.xml
trans.he_IL = res/values-iw-rIL/strings.xml
trans.hi_IN = res/values-hi-rIN/strings.xml
trans.it_IT = res/values-it-rIT/strings.xml
trans.ko = res/values-ko/strings.xml
trans.nl = res/values-nl/strings.xml
trans.pl_PL = res/values-pl-rPL/strings.xml
trans.pt = res/values-pt/strings.xml
trans.pt_BR = res/values-pt-rBR/strings.xml
trans.ro_RO = res/values-ro-rRO/strings.xml
trans.ru = res/values-ru/strings.xml
trans.ru-RU = res/values-ru/strings.xml
trans.ru_RU = res/values-ru/strings.xml
trans.uk_UA = res/values-uk-rUA/strings.xml
trans.zh_CN = res/values-zh-rCN/strings.xml
trans.sv_SE = res/values-sv-rSE/strings.xml
trans.az = core/src/main/res/values-az/strings.xml
trans.ca = core/src/main/res/values-ca/strings.xml
trans.cs_CZ = core/src/main/res/values-cs-rCZ/strings.xml
trans.da = core/src/main/res/values-da/strings.xml
trans.de = core/src/main/res/values-de/strings.xml
trans.es = core/src/main/res/values-es/strings.xml
trans.es_ES = core/src/main/res/values-es-rES/strings.xml
trans.fr = core/src/main/res/values-fr/strings.xml
trans.he_IL = core/src/main/res/values-iw-rIL/strings.xml
trans.hi_IN = core/src/main/res/values-hi-rIN/strings.xml
trans.it_IT = core/src/main/res/values-it-rIT/strings.xml
trans.ko = core/src/main/res/values-ko/strings.xml
trans.nl = core/src/main/res/values-nl/strings.xml
trans.pl_PL = core/src/main/res/values-pl-rPL/strings.xml
trans.pt = core/src/main/res/values-pt/strings.xml
trans.pt_BR = core/src/main/res/values-pt-rBR/strings.xml
trans.ro_RO = core/src/main/res/values-ro-rRO/strings.xml
trans.ru = core/src/main/res/values-ru/strings.xml
trans.ru-RU = core/src/main/res/values-ru/strings.xml
trans.ru_RU = core/src/main/res/values-ru/strings.xml
trans.uk_UA = core/src/main/res/values-uk-rUA/strings.xml
trans.zh_CN = core/src/main/res/values-zh-rCN/strings.xml
trans.sv_SE = core/src/main/res/values-sv-rSE/strings.xml
[antennapod.description]
file_filter = description/<lang>.txt

View File

@ -288,6 +288,12 @@
android:value="de.danoeh.antennapod.activity.PreferenceActivity"/>
</activity>
<receiver android:name=".receiver.ConnectivityActionReceiver">
<intent-filter>
<action android:name="android.net.conn.CONNECTIVITY_CHANGE"/>
</intent-filter>
</receiver>
<receiver android:name=".receiver.SPAReceiver">
<intent-filter>
<action android:name="de.danoeh.antennapdsp.intent.SP_APPS_QUERY_FEEDS_RESPONSE"/>

View File

@ -8,6 +8,7 @@ import android.content.Intent;
import de.danoeh.antennapod.PodcastApp;
import de.danoeh.antennapod.activity.StorageErrorActivity;
import de.danoeh.antennapod.core.ApplicationCallbacks;
import de.danoeh.antennapod.core.preferences.UserPreferences;
public class ApplicationCallbacksImpl implements ApplicationCallbacks {
@ -20,4 +21,9 @@ public class ApplicationCallbacksImpl implements ApplicationCallbacks {
public Intent getStorageErrorActivity(Context context) {
return new Intent(context, StorageErrorActivity.class);
}
@Override
public void setUpdateInterval(long updateInterval) {
UserPreferences.restartUpdateAlarm(updateInterval, updateInterval);
}
}

View File

@ -9,6 +9,7 @@ import de.danoeh.antennapod.activity.DownloadAuthenticationActivity;
import de.danoeh.antennapod.activity.MainActivity;
import de.danoeh.antennapod.adapter.NavListAdapter;
import de.danoeh.antennapod.core.DownloadServiceCallbacks;
import de.danoeh.antennapod.core.feed.Feed;
import de.danoeh.antennapod.core.service.download.DownloadRequest;
import de.danoeh.antennapod.fragment.DownloadsFragment;
@ -46,4 +47,14 @@ public class DownloadServiceCallbacksImpl implements DownloadServiceCallbacks {
intent.putExtra(MainActivity.EXTRA_FRAGMENT_ARGS, args);
return PendingIntent.getActivity(context, 0, intent, PendingIntent.FLAG_UPDATE_CURRENT);
}
@Override
public void onFeedParsed(Context context, Feed feed) {
// do nothing
}
@Override
public boolean shouldCreateReport() {
return true;
}
}

View File

@ -3,6 +3,7 @@ package de.danoeh.antennapod.config;
import android.content.Context;
import android.content.Intent;
import de.danoeh.antennapod.R;
import de.danoeh.antennapod.activity.AudioplayerActivity;
import de.danoeh.antennapod.activity.VideoplayerActivity;
import de.danoeh.antennapod.core.PlaybackServiceCallbacks;
@ -18,4 +19,14 @@ public class PlaybackServiceCallbacksImpl implements PlaybackServiceCallbacks {
return new Intent(context, AudioplayerActivity.class);
}
}
@Override
public boolean useQueue() {
return true;
}
@Override
public int getNotificationIconResource(Context context) {
return R.drawable.ic_stat_antenna_default;
}
}

View File

@ -1,4 +1,4 @@
package de.danoeh.antennapod.core.receiver;
package de.danoeh.antennapod.receiver;
import android.content.BroadcastReceiver;
import android.content.Context;

View File

@ -20,5 +20,5 @@ public interface ApplicationCallbacks {
*/
public Intent getStorageErrorActivity(Context context);
public void setUpateInterval(long upateInterval);
public void setUpdateInterval(long updateInterval);
}

View File

@ -330,7 +330,7 @@ public class UserPreferences implements
} else if (key.equals(PREF_UPDATE_INTERVAL)) {
updateInterval = readUpdateInterval(sp.getString(
PREF_UPDATE_INTERVAL, "0"));
ClientConfig.applicationCallbacks.setUpateInterval(updateInterval);
ClientConfig.applicationCallbacks.setUpdateInterval(updateInterval);
} else if (key.equals(PREF_AUTO_DELETE)) {
autoDelete = sp.getBoolean(PREF_AUTO_DELETE, false);

View File

@ -27,7 +27,7 @@ public class AlarmUpdateReceiver extends BroadcastReceiver {
Log.d(TAG, "Resetting update alarm after app upgrade");
}
ClientConfig.applicationCallbacks.setUpateInterval(UserPreferences.getUpdateInterval());
ClientConfig.applicationCallbacks.setUpdateInterval(UserPreferences.getUpdateInterval());
}